Skip to content

Commit d6b5c0e

Browse files
authored
Merge branch 'main' into AVIO-529
2 parents 6437d2e + de42255 commit d6b5c0e

File tree

3 files changed

+66
-238
lines changed

3 files changed

+66
-238
lines changed
Lines changed: 36 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-1,61 +1,69 @@
11
public with sharing class NKS_SkattekortWrapper {
22
@AuraEnabled
33
@TestVisible
4-
public Integer inntektsaar { get; private set; }
5-
4+
public String utstedtDato { get; private set; }
5+
66
@AuraEnabled
77
@TestVisible
8-
public String arbeidstakeridentifikator { get; private set; }
9-
8+
public Integer inntektsaar { get; private set; }
9+
1010
@AuraEnabled
1111
@TestVisible
12-
public String resultatPaaForespoersel { get; private set; }
13-
12+
public String resultatForSkattekort { get; private set; }
13+
1414
@AuraEnabled
1515
@TestVisible
16-
public Skattekort skattekort { get; private set; }
17-
16+
public List<Forskuddstrekk> forskuddstrekkList { get; private set; }
17+
1818
@AuraEnabled
1919
@TestVisible
20-
public List<String> tilleggsopplysning { get; private set; }
20+
public List<String> tilleggsopplysningList { get; private set; }
2121

22-
public class Skattekort {
22+
public class Frikort {
2323
@AuraEnabled
2424
@TestVisible
25-
public String utstedtDato { get; private set; }
26-
25+
public Integer frikortBeloep { get; private set; }
26+
}
27+
28+
public class Prosentkort {
2729
@AuraEnabled
2830
@TestVisible
29-
public Integer skattekortidentifikator { get; private set; }
30-
31+
public Double prosentSats { get; private set; }
32+
3133
@AuraEnabled
3234
@TestVisible
33-
public List<Forskuddstrekk> forskuddstrekk { get; private set; }
35+
public Double antallMndForTrekk { get; private set; }
3436
}
3537

36-
public class Forskuddstrekk {
38+
public class Trekktabell {
39+
@AuraEnabled
40+
@TestVisible
41+
public String tabell { get; private set; }
42+
3743
@AuraEnabled
3844
@TestVisible
39-
public String type { get; private set; }
40-
45+
public Double prosentSats { get; private set; }
46+
4147
@AuraEnabled
4248
@TestVisible
43-
public String trekkode { get; private set; }
44-
49+
public Double antallMndForTrekk { get; private set; }
50+
}
51+
52+
public class Forskuddstrekk {
4553
@AuraEnabled
4654
@TestVisible
47-
public Double prosentsats { get; private set; }
48-
55+
public String trekkode { get; private set; }
56+
4957
@AuraEnabled
5058
@TestVisible
51-
public Double frikortbeloep { get; private set; }
52-
59+
public Frikort frikort { get; private set; }
60+
5361
@AuraEnabled
5462
@TestVisible
55-
public String tabellnummer { get; private set; }
56-
63+
public Prosentkort prosentkort { get; private set; }
64+
5765
@AuraEnabled
5866
@TestVisible
59-
public Double antallMaanederForTrekk { get; private set; }
67+
public Trekktabell trekktabell { get; private set; }
6068
}
61-
}
69+
}
Lines changed: 29 additions & 209 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,5 @@
11
<?xml version="1.0" encoding="UTF-8"?>
2-
<CustomMetadata xmlns="http://soap.sforce.com/2006/04/metadata"
3-
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
4-
xmlns:xsd="http://www.w3.org/2001/XMLSchema">
2+
<CustomMetadata xmlns="http://soap.sforce.com/2006/04/metadata"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
53
<label>POST_SKATTEKORT_API</label>
64
<protected>false</protected>
75
<values>
@@ -22,211 +20,33 @@
2220
&quot;200&quot;: {
2321
&quot;headers&quot;: null,
2422
&quot;body&quot;:
25-
[{
26-
&quot;inntektsaar&quot;: 2025,
27-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
28-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
29-
&quot;skattekort&quot;: {
30-
&quot;forskuddstrekk&quot;: [
31-
{
32-
&quot;type&quot;: &quot;Trekkprosent&quot;,
33-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
34-
&quot;prosentsats&quot;: 22.20
35-
},
36-
{
37-
&quot;type&quot;: &quot;Trekkprosent&quot;,
38-
&quot;trekkode&quot;: &quot;pensjonFraNAV&quot;,
39-
&quot;prosentsats&quot;: 15.00
40-
}
41-
]
42-
},
43-
&quot;tilleggsopplysning&quot;: [
44-
&quot;kildeskattPaaPensjon&quot;
45-
]
46-
},
47-
{
48-
&quot;inntektsaar&quot;: 2025,
49-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
50-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
51-
&quot;skattekort&quot;: {
52-
&quot;utstedtDato&quot;: &quot;2025-12-04&quot;,
53-
&quot;skattekortidentifikator&quot;: 72883,
54-
&quot;forskuddstrekk&quot;: [
55-
{
56-
&quot;type&quot;: &quot;Trekkprosent&quot;,
57-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
58-
&quot;prosentsats&quot;: 22.20
59-
}
60-
]
61-
},
62-
&quot;tilleggsopplysning&quot;: [
63-
&quot;kildeskattPaaPensjon&quot;
64-
]
65-
},
66-
{
67-
&quot;inntektsaar&quot;: 2025,
68-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
69-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
70-
&quot;skattekort&quot;: {
71-
&quot;forskuddstrekk&quot;: [
72-
{
73-
&quot;type&quot;: &quot;Trekkprosent&quot;,
74-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
75-
&quot;prosentsats&quot;: 22.20
76-
},
77-
{
78-
&quot;type&quot;: &quot;Trekkprosent&quot;,
79-
&quot;trekkode&quot;: &quot;pensjonFraNAV&quot;,
80-
&quot;prosentsats&quot;: 15.00
81-
}
82-
]
83-
},
84-
&quot;tilleggsopplysning&quot;: [
85-
&quot;kildeskattPaaPensjon&quot;
86-
]
87-
},
88-
{
89-
&quot;inntektsaar&quot;: 2025,
90-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
91-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
92-
&quot;skattekort&quot;: {
93-
&quot;utstedtDato&quot;: &quot;2025-12-05&quot;,
94-
&quot;skattekortidentifikator&quot;: 73599,
95-
&quot;forskuddstrekk&quot;: [
96-
{
97-
&quot;type&quot;: &quot;Trekkprosent&quot;,
98-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
99-
&quot;prosentsats&quot;: 22.20
100-
}
101-
]
102-
},
103-
&quot;tilleggsopplysning&quot;: [
104-
&quot;kildeskattPaaPensjon&quot;
105-
]
106-
},
107-
{
108-
&quot;inntektsaar&quot;: 2025,
109-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
110-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
111-
&quot;skattekort&quot;: {
112-
&quot;forskuddstrekk&quot;: [
113-
{
114-
&quot;type&quot;: &quot;Trekkprosent&quot;,
115-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
116-
&quot;prosentsats&quot;: 22.20
117-
},
118-
{
119-
&quot;type&quot;: &quot;Trekkprosent&quot;,
120-
&quot;trekkode&quot;: &quot;pensjonFraNAV&quot;,
121-
&quot;prosentsats&quot;: 15.00
122-
}
123-
]
124-
},
125-
&quot;tilleggsopplysning&quot;: [
126-
&quot;kildeskattPaaPensjon&quot;
127-
]
128-
},
129-
{
130-
&quot;inntektsaar&quot;: 2025,
131-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
132-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
133-
&quot;skattekort&quot;: {
134-
&quot;utstedtDato&quot;: &quot;2025-12-06&quot;,
135-
&quot;skattekortidentifikator&quot;: 74315,
136-
&quot;forskuddstrekk&quot;: [
137-
{
138-
&quot;type&quot;: &quot;Trekkprosent&quot;,
139-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
140-
&quot;prosentsats&quot;: 22.20
141-
}
142-
]
143-
},
144-
&quot;tilleggsopplysning&quot;: [
145-
&quot;kildeskattPaaPensjon&quot;
146-
]
147-
},
148-
{
149-
&quot;inntektsaar&quot;: 2025,
150-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
151-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
152-
&quot;skattekort&quot;: {
153-
&quot;forskuddstrekk&quot;: [
154-
{
155-
&quot;type&quot;: &quot;Trekkprosent&quot;,
156-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
157-
&quot;prosentsats&quot;: 22.20
158-
},
159-
{
160-
&quot;type&quot;: &quot;Trekkprosent&quot;,
161-
&quot;trekkode&quot;: &quot;pensjonFraNAV&quot;,
162-
&quot;prosentsats&quot;: 15.00
163-
}
164-
]
165-
},
166-
&quot;tilleggsopplysning&quot;: [
167-
&quot;kildeskattPaaPensjon&quot;
168-
]
169-
},
170-
{
171-
&quot;inntektsaar&quot;: 2025,
172-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
173-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
174-
&quot;skattekort&quot;: {
175-
&quot;utstedtDato&quot;: &quot;2025-12-08&quot;,
176-
&quot;skattekortidentifikator&quot;: 75747,
177-
&quot;forskuddstrekk&quot;: [
178-
{
179-
&quot;type&quot;: &quot;Trekkprosent&quot;,
180-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
181-
&quot;prosentsats&quot;: 22.20
182-
}
183-
]
184-
},
185-
&quot;tilleggsopplysning&quot;: [
186-
&quot;kildeskattPaaPensjon&quot;
187-
]
188-
},
189-
{
190-
&quot;inntektsaar&quot;: 2025,
191-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
192-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
193-
&quot;skattekort&quot;: {
194-
&quot;forskuddstrekk&quot;: [
195-
{
196-
&quot;type&quot;: &quot;Trekkprosent&quot;,
197-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
198-
&quot;prosentsats&quot;: 22.20
199-
},
200-
{
201-
&quot;type&quot;: &quot;Trekkprosent&quot;,
202-
&quot;trekkode&quot;: &quot;pensjonFraNAV&quot;,
203-
&quot;prosentsats&quot;: 15.00
204-
}
205-
]
206-
},
207-
&quot;tilleggsopplysning&quot;: [
208-
&quot;kildeskattPaaPensjon&quot;
209-
]
210-
},
211-
{
212-
&quot;inntektsaar&quot;: 2025,
213-
&quot;arbeidstakeridentifikator&quot;: &quot;29860299923&quot;,
214-
&quot;resultatPaaForespoersel&quot;: &quot;skattekortopplysningerOK&quot;,
215-
&quot;skattekort&quot;: {
216-
&quot;utstedtDato&quot;: &quot;2025-12-09&quot;,
217-
&quot;skattekortidentifikator&quot;: 76463,
218-
&quot;forskuddstrekk&quot;: [
219-
{
220-
&quot;type&quot;: &quot;Trekkprosent&quot;,
221-
&quot;trekkode&quot;: &quot;ufoeretrygdFraNAV&quot;,
222-
&quot;prosentsats&quot;: 22.20
223-
}
224-
]
225-
},
226-
&quot;tilleggsopplysning&quot;: [
227-
&quot;kildeskattPaaPensjon&quot;
228-
]
229-
}]
23+
[
24+
{
25+
&quot;utstedtDato&quot;: &quot;2026-02-10&quot;,
26+
&quot;inntektsaar&quot;: 2026,
27+
&quot;resultatForSkattekort&quot;: &quot;skattekortopplysningerOK&quot;,
28+
&quot;forskuddstrekkList&quot;: [
29+
{
30+
&quot;trekkode&quot;: &quot;string&quot;,
31+
&quot;frikort&quot;: {
32+
&quot;frikortBeloep&quot;: 0
33+
},
34+
&quot;prosentkort&quot;: {
35+
&quot;prosentSats&quot;: 0,
36+
&quot;antallMndForTrekk&quot;: 0
37+
},
38+
&quot;trekktabell&quot;: {
39+
&quot;tabell&quot;: &quot;string&quot;,
40+
&quot;prosentSats&quot;: 0,
41+
&quot;antallMndForTrekk&quot;: 0
42+
}
43+
}
44+
],
45+
&quot;tilleggsopplysningList&quot;: [
46+
&quot;oppholdPaaSvalbard&quot;
47+
]
48+
}
49+
]
23050
},
23151
&quot;401&quot;: {
23252
&quot;headers&quot;: null,
@@ -264,4 +84,4 @@
26484
<field>Service_Path__c</field>
26585
<value xsi:type="xsd:string">/api/v1/hent-skattekort</value>
26686
</values>
267-
</CustomMetadata>
87+
</CustomMetadata>

sfdx-project.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@
77
{
88
"path": "force-app",
99
"package": "crm-platform-integration",
10-
"versionNumber": "0.169.0.NEXT",
10+
"versionNumber": "0.170.0.NEXT",
1111
"definitionFile": "config/scratch-def.json",
1212
"dependencies": [
1313
{

0 commit comments

Comments
 (0)